## Configuration

Dark mode in the Lanternfall admin dashboard is theme-flag driven — no rebuild needed, just flip `THEME_DARK_ENABLED=true` and reload. Per-user overrides are stored server-side, so the theme service needs its signing credential available at startup. Before cutting the release, make sure the env file includes the next line right after the theme flags.

vault entry, yahif-yajep: COURIER_KEY29=b802bdf8034096b65a51c6ba5abe2

Handover — Frostline serverless team. New folks: cold starts on the Pellman handlers were killing checkout latency. We added provisioned warm pools, trimmed the dependency tree, and moved init work out of the handler body. Median cold start dropped from 2.1s to 400ms. Don't add heavy SDKs at import time — that's how we got here. Warm pool sizing is tuned per region; ask Odessa before changing it. The warmer lambda runs with the following configuration values.

config for kafof-bawef:
holath:
  log_level: debug
  metrics_host: metrics.holath.qorvelsys.internal
  pin: 2191
  pool_size: 32

Step 4: Configure the production narration backend for EchoDocent, the audio-guide app deployed at the fictional Marrowfield Gallery. Before tagging the release, confirm the environment file on the release host contains the current content-delivery credentials. Rotate them if the previous release manager has departed. Then append the following line to .env.

env line for kageg-fajof: COURIER_KEY5=93d14

A: No. All prefetch requests to the Cartwell tile service are made over mutually authenticated TLS, and tile URLs are derived server-side from signed viewport hints, never from client-supplied paths. The prefetch queue is bounded and rejects hints outside the user's authorized region set, which mitigates enumeration of restricted tile layers. Cached tiles are stored encrypted at rest and keyed per session. If you need the threat model document or want to report a suspected bypass, contact the prefetch security owner.

billing contact of tahaf-kafop = istwyn_fraox@norvaworks.corp